The ever-changing world of the office workplace and how it is impacting culture and relationships

Carissa Kilgour from Co.Lab returns to discuss shifts in the office workplace and how businesses are rethinking their use of workspaces. How can companies foster collaboration when employees are remote? Will the trend of mass migration to big cities fade? How do you maintain workplace culture without a physical office? Build relationships with colleagues you rarely see? Train leaders to manage remotely? Listen to our podcast below:
